Detention refers to the time outside the port. If the consignee holds on to the carrier’s container beyond the allowed free days, detention will be imposed. In other words, a detention charge is applied when the container has been picked up, but not returned to the carrier. The Park County Detention Center is a 106 bed, short term, detention facility designed to hold both female and male adults as well as female and male juveniles. We are a County facility operated under the authority of the Sheriff, as directed by Wyoming State Statutes. We are not a State facility or a Federal facility.
We hold both sentenced and un-sentenced (pre-trial) individuals. Persons who are pre-trial and unable to post bond will have varying lengths of stays determined greatly upon the inmate and their attorney. Persons who are sentenced to serve time by the Courts can have sentences imposed that could range from one day, up to one year.
The Park County Detention Center holds inmate for Cody and Powell Municipal Courts, Park County Circuit Court, and the Park County District Court. All inmates being held in the Park County Detention Center have charges that originated in Park County; we currently do not hold any inmates from outside the County.
The Park County Detention Center staff consists of, one Administrator, one Administrative Assistant, four Sworn Detention Sergeants, twenty-one Sworn Detention Deputies, two full time cooks, and two part time cooks. We are a twenty-four hour, seven day a week operation, tasked with the safe keeping of those placed in our custody. This is not a task that we take lightly, and strive to perform this task with empathy, and consistency. Our average population ranges in the fifties and sixties, with the highest population to date of eighty-nine.

Mission Statement of the Park County Detention Center
The mission of the Park County Detention Center is the safe and secure confinement and management of persons who have been placed into our custody. To serve the citizens of Park County to the best of our ability utilizing every resource made available to us.
The Park County Detention Center will work in cooperation with local law enforcement agencies, the courts, and the criminal justice system to ensure an individual is present for court appearances and to ensure the completion of court imposed sentences. Approaching blocks download free.
The Park County Detention Center will confine persons in a responsible and humane manner that maintains self-dignity. The Park County Detention Center will strive to ensure that individuals leave the facility in no worse condition, physically or psychologically,
than when they entered.
With the belief that change is always possible, the Park County Detention Center will make available opportunities for inmates to become involved in community-based programs which strive to promote change, self esteem and a positive approach to a law-abiding lifestyle.

The Park County Detention Center will provide a safe and positive work environment for staff. It will operate in accordance with the statutes of the State of Wyoming and the Constitution of the United States of America.
A Policy and Procedure manual will be maintained to establish facility guidelines for the safety of staff and inmates. To insure that the operation of the Park County Detention Center does not violate an individual’s Constitutional Rights and remains current with
State Statutes and Regulations.

Staff & Vision
The Butte-Silver Bow Detention Center was built in 2004. The detention center operates 365 days a year and employs 27 Detention Officers and five civilian staff. The detention center has an inmate capacity of 72. It is the mission of the Butte-Silver Bow Detention Center to provide a safe and secure environment for the housing of inmates placed under our care in accordance with local, state, and federal requirements.
Inmate Classification
All inmates at the Butte-Silver Bow Detention Center are classified using a specific system, which is basically a risk assessment. The classification of all inmates, security of other inmates and detention staff is greatly increased. We have a team of detention officers that research the inmate’s personal and criminal history. They also consider the inmate’s past and present behavior when in custody. Mental or physical disabilities are also reviewed when determining appropriate housing.
Upon completion of the classification process, inmates are placed in housing units that range from minimum to maximum-security levels.

Intake and Booking
The Butte-Silver Bow Detention Center’s intake / booking area is where all arrested adults are processed. Our staff uses the highest professional standards while maintaining the respect and dignity of those arrested. Arrested individuals are brought to our detention center and turned over to our booking officers. The intake process begins and arrestees are asked a series of questions by the booking officer.
The arrestees are then booked in, photographed, and fingerprinted. Once this process is competed, they are allowed to use the phone to contact a bondsmen, family member, or friends. If the arrestee cannot bond out or the offense is not bondable, they are transferred to the housing unit after classification. There is a $25 booking fee assessed on all arrestees.

Inmate Programs
We offer both Alcoholic Anonymous and Narcotics Anonymous. We have a therapist that is able to assist with mental health and cognitive-based programming. This programming has a positive effect on both the inmates, as well as the community. It assists in reducing recidivism, which directly effects healthcare and law enforcement costs.
Health Services
The purpose of the health services is to provide quality medical care while at the Butte-Silver Bow Detention Center. We make our health care services available to all inmates. We have a mental health therapist, registered nurse and medical doctor that provide the medical care. Emergency dental care is also available.
We do charge a co-pay for medical services and prescription medications. The co-pay will not exceed $10. We do not charge a co-pay for mental health services. Our health care providers work hard to meet the needs of all of our patients.
